neuf
Etymology 2
From Old French nuef, from Latin novus.
Adjective
neuf m (feminine singular neuve, masculine plural neufs, feminine plural neuves)
Related terms
- quoi de neuf
- nouveau (for “new” items, but those that are not fresh from the factory for example)
